Lennard has enjoyed the comforts of home their last three games, but now they'll head out on the road. They will head out to challenge the Lakewood Ranch Mustangs at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. Lennard's defense has only allowed 11.8 points per game this season, so Lakewood Ranch's offense will have their work cut out for them.
Lennard is headed in fresh off scoring the most points they have all season. They blew past Leto 48-6 at home on Friday. Given the Longhorns' advantage in MaxPreps' Florida football rankings (they are ranked 185th, while the Falcons are ranked 450th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
It was another big night for Gavin Fields, who rushed for 118 yards and a touchdown on only six carries, and also picked up 30 receiving yards. He got the majority of those rushing yards when he took off on a run that went for an incredible 80 yards. Jacob Mobley was another key player, throwing for 132 yards and two touchdowns.
Lennard's defense stepped up as well, laying out RJ Swain. ten times. Jaiden Jones led the group effort, picking up three of those sacks all by himself. He is also on a roll when it comes to total tackles, as he's now made five or more in the last four games he's played dating back to last season.
Meanwhile, Lakewood Ranch gave up the first points two weeks ago, but they didn't let that get them down. They secured a 28-22 W over Southeast. The victory made it back-to-back wins for the Mustangs.
Lennard's win was their fourth straight at home dating back to last season, which pushed their record up to 5-0. As for Lakewood Ranch, their victory bumped their record up to 3-1.
